How to fill out the Msds online
This guide provides clear, step-by-step instructions on how to accurately fill out the Material Safety Data Sheet (Msds) online. Understanding each component of the form is essential for maintaining safety and compliance in any handling of hazardous materials.
Follow the steps to complete the Msds form accurately.

- Begin by filling out Section 1, which includes the chemical product and company identification. Provide the product name, contact information, catalog codes, and relevant chemical details as specified.
- Move to Section 2, where you will list the composition and information on ingredients. Include names, CAS numbers, and the percentage by weight for each ingredient in the product.
- In Section 3, identify potential hazards. Specify any acute or chronic health effects the material may have, including routes of exposure.
- For Section 4, detail the first aid measures for each type of exposure (eye, skin, inhalation, and ingestion) to ensure prompt response in case of accidents.
- In Section 5, provide information regarding fire and explosion data, including flammability and advice on firefighting measures.
- Complete Section 6 by describing accident release measures for small and large spills, including neutralization procedures and recommendations for containment.
- Proceed to Section 7 to note handling and storage precautions. Include advice on keeping the product away from incompatible materials and ensuring a safe storage environment.
- For Section 8, specify exposure controls and personal protection measures. List recommended protective equipment and engineering controls.
- Continue with Section 9, detailing the physical and chemical properties of the chemical. Include information on the physical state, pH, boiling point, and solubility.
- In Section 10, provide stability and reactivity information, including conditions to avoid and incompatible substances.
- Complete Section 11 with toxicological information regarding how the material affects health and any long-term effects.
- In Section 12, include ecological information regarding the environmental impact and biodegradability of the substance.
- Fill in Section 13 on disposal considerations, outlining appropriate waste disposal methods.
- In Section 14, provide transport information, indicating the classification and identification of the substance during transport.
- Continue to Section 15 with any other regulatory information relevant to federal and state regulations.
- Finally, review Section 16 for additional instructions or references, then save your completed form.

Organizing your MSDS sheets requires a clear and systematic approach. You may choose to categorize them by product type, usage, or hazard level for easy access. Consider maintaining both physical and digital copies for convenience and safety compliance.
